Greers Ferry National Fish Hatchery

Greers Ferry National Fish Hatchery, established in 1965, is nestled along the beautiful tailwaters of the Little Red River below Greers Ferry Dam. Nearby you'll find excellent opportunities for camping and world class trout fishing year-round. In cooperation with the State game and fish agencies of Arkansas and Oklahoma, the hatchery provides mandated mitigation of Rainbow and Brook Trout.
